decimal(10,2) 是什么意思 在一個表中 decimal(10,2)中的“2”表示小數部分的位數,如果插入的值未指定小數部分或者小數部分不足兩位則會自動補到2位小數,若插入的值小數部分超過了2為則會發生截斷,截取前 ...
Sql中的decimal a,b decimal a,b a指定指定小數點左邊和右邊可以存儲的十進制數字的最大個數,最大精度 。 b指定小數點右邊可以存儲的十進制數字的最大個數。小數位數必須是從 到 a之間的值。默認小數位數是 ...
2012-04-02 18:18 0 5420 推薦指數:
decimal(10,2) 是什么意思 在一個表中 decimal(10,2)中的“2”表示小數部分的位數,如果插入的值未指定小數部分或者小數部分不足兩位則會自動補到2位小數,若插入的值小數部分超過了2為則會發生截斷,截取前 ...
numeric 和 decimal 數據類型的默認最大精度值是 38。在 Transact-SQL 中,numeric 與 decimal 數據類型在功能上等效。decimal(numeric ) 同義,用於精確存儲數值decimal 數據類型最多可存儲 38 個數字,所有數字都能夠放到小數點 ...
numeric 和 decimal 數據類型的默認最大精度值是 38。在 Transact-SQL 中,numeric 與 decimal 數據類型在功能上等效。decimal(numeric ) 同義,用於精確存儲數值decimal 數據類型最多可存儲 38 個數字,所有數字都能夠放到小數點 ...
decimal(m,n)的意思是m位數中,有n位是小數,即m-n位整數。 上述實例decimal(5,2)的意思是三位整數和兩位小數 例1 整數有四位會出現數據溢出錯誤 消息 8115,級別 16,狀態 8,第 129 行將 int 轉換為數據類型 ...
概述: 浮點數據類型包括real型、float型、decimal型和numeric型。浮點數據類型用於存儲十進制小數。 在SQL Server 中浮點數值的數據采用上舍入(Round up)的方式進行存儲,所謂上舍入也就是,要舍入的小數部分不論其大小, 只要是一個非零的數,就要在該數字 ...
decimal(18,0),數值中共有18位數,其中整數占18位,小數占0位。Decimal(n,m)表示數值中共有n位數,其中整數n-m位,小數m位。 例:decimal(2,1),此時,插入數據“12.3”、“12”等會出現“數據溢出錯誤”的異常;插入“1.23”或“1.2345... ...
postgresql中的該類型精度支持到1000位,采用變長方式存儲,那么如何通過atttypmod來獲取到定義的precision和scale呢? 兩種方法: 1.觀察二進制: numeric(5,4) => 327688 0101 0000 0000 0000 1000 ...
float,double,decimal區別 創建表test_float_double_decimal 第一條數據插入后,float都跑偏了,double還算正常(最后位值四舍五入),decimal正常(最后位值四舍五入)。 第二條數據插入后發現,float跑偏最嚴重 ...